Ange Postecoglou’s second season at Tottenham Hotspur hasn’t exactly been a Premier League fairytale. After a promising start, injuries and inconsistent performances have seen Spurs languishing lower in the table than fans in North London are accustomed to. Currently sitting mid-table, the pressure is mounting. Is Postecoglou on the hot seat? For many fans, the answer is a resounding yes. But others still believe in the Aussie manager’s vision. So, what does Ange need to do to secure his future at Tottenham?
1. Conquer Europe: Win the Europa League
Tottenham’s Europa League campaign offers a glimmer of hope. After a strong showing in the knockout stages, Spurs find themselves in the hunt for their first major trophy since 2008. Think of it as their “Bad News Bears” moment – a chance to defy expectations and rewrite the narrative of their season. With a favorable path to the final,Tottenham has a real shot at glory.
Winning the Europa League isn’t just about silverware; it’s a golden ticket to next season’s Champions League.For a team struggling to secure a top-four finish in the Premier League, this represents their best, and perhaps only, route back to Europe’s elite competition. It’s a high-stakes gamble, but the potential reward is immense.
Postecoglou has a proven track record of success in his second seasons. At Celtic, he followed up a League Cup and Scottish Premiership title in his first year with a domestic treble in his second.
Before that, he transformed Yokohama F. Marinos, winning the J1 League in his second year after reaching a cup final in his first.Can he replicate that magic at Tottenham? A Europa League triumph could be the ultimate job security.
However, some argue that focusing solely on the Europa League is a risky strategy. Critics point to the importance of Premier League form for long-term stability. But Postecoglou might see this as a calculated gamble, prioritizing a trophy and champions League qualification over a slightly improved league position. It’s a bold move, but one that could define his tenure.
2. Secure the Future: Make Mathys Tel a Permanent Spur
Tottenham’s legendary captain, Heung-Min Son, is showing signs of age. While still a valuable asset, his pace and explosiveness aren’t what they once were. The club needs to plan for the future, and that’s where Mathys Tel comes in.
Spurs secured Tel on loan from bayern Munich, a player with a similar skillset to Son. Initially hesitant, Tel was convinced by Postecoglou’s vision for his role in the team. Now, Tottenham has the option to make the move permanent.But there’s a catch: Tel himself must agree to the transfer.
Postecoglou needs to sell Tel on the long-term project at Tottenham. Giving him critically important playing time, especially with Son’s recent injury, is crucial. A strong finish to the season, capped off by a Europa League victory, would undoubtedly boost Tel’s confidence in a permanent move to North London. Think of it as recruiting a top prospect in college football – you need to show them the program is on the rise and that they’ll be a key part of its success.
Some might argue that relying on a young, unproven player like Tel is too risky. They might prefer Tottenham to pursue a more established star. Though,Tel’s potential is undeniable,and Postecoglou clearly sees him as a vital piece of the puzzle. Securing his signature would be a major coup and a statement of intent for the future.
